SDG 13 — Climate Action

Climate action is happening everywhere — in homes, schools, businesses, farms, councils, and communities — often led by young people who are turning worry into practical change. SDG 13 is about cutting emissions, building resilience, adapting to climate impacts, and protecting the most vulnerable. It’s also about solutions that improve everyday life: warmer homes, cleaner air, safer streets, healthier food, thriving nature, and stronger communities.
